In a 13,000-square-meter community park, boulders, representing eternity and guardianship, are used as the core design elements of the garden and are naturally integrated with activity and experience functions. For example, boulders lying on the sand pit can be transformed into climbing and resting game devices; stones in shallow streams can become part of water play devices. The huge cave exploration space is creatively realized by the increasingly mature 3D-printed concrete technology.


Design Background


The Boulder Park is located in the Yunwan Garden of Vanke Xueshan City, Jinan, Shandong Province. It covers an area of approximately 13,000 square meters in the community center and is a comprehensive community park integrating children's play, shallow stream water play, parent-child companionship, and natural leisure. According to style characteristics and functional needs, it is generally divided into an all-age boulder playground, a water garden, a forest garden, a stone garden, and a flower garden. Among them, the children's activity area hosted by Xisui includes the all-age boulder playground, the water garden, and the forest garden.

Boulder Playground



In terms of participation and experience, the all-age boulder playground and forest garden integrate a variety of children's activity functions that are endlessly fun, such as swings, slides, sliding poles, trampolines, rocking horses, seesaws, turntables, drilling cylinders, speaking tubes, and climbing ropes, into the landscape area created by natural boulders and concrete caves. This helps children enjoy their outdoor time while exercising the strength of their upper and lower limbs and promoting the development of their brain's natural cognition and balance.

Water Playground



The water garden on the west side of the Boulder Park gently outlines a fun outdoor water play park that blends with nature, using a gently flowing shallow stream as a brush. The Xisui team, like craftsmen in a fairy tale, carefully carves details, customizing water play experiences for explorers of all ages:


All children are invited to play by the spring, feeling the delicate touch of the flowing water; older children can play by the playful jumping fountain and "explore" in the winding stream; the water turntable, with its rotating dance, attracts young children to enter a dream journey of water and wind; the water fetching device and the press water fetching device are like hidden puzzles, waiting for each little explorer to unlock, stimulating the desire to explore, and each success is a wonderful reward for childhood cooperation with water.


In this water park, games become keys that open children's doors to nature, making every step in the water and every laugh a precious memory of feeling the gentle power of water and experiencing equal coexistence with nature.

Core Device



Several of the most eye-catching participation devices in the venue are made using cutting-edge international construction technology—3D concrete printing. This is an advanced manufacturing method based on a digital model that forms a physical structure by layer-by-layer accumulation of materials. This technology uses a computer-controlled robotic arm to precisely extrude liquid or semi-solid concrete materials, which then quickly solidify, building layer by layer until the entire structure is completed. Its core lies in the close integration of digital design and materials science, giving the field of real-space design and construction unprecedented freedom and complexity. This process has a unique layered rock texture that blends with the texture of natural boulders and caves. At the same time, its advantages of one-piece molding of irregular curved surfaces improve the accuracy of the space and the smoothness of the experience.

One-Piece Molding



With the help of digitally controlled shape printing technology, complex irregular curved surfaces can be integrally formed. This not only significantly improves the accuracy of the shape and effectively avoids errors that are difficult to avoid in traditional processes, but also reduces reliance on manual skills, demonstrating the close integration of technology and art.

Layered Rock Canyon



The unique layered rock texture of the 3D printing process complements the surrounding natural stone landscape, meeting current functional needs while maintaining an atmosphere of exploration and wild fun. Children play among the "boulders," as if shuttling through real canyons.


Meanwhile, the subtle curved surfaces naturally give rise to bumps and slopes, forming elements such as steps, handrails, slides, and caregiver seats. This achieves a harmonious unity of functionality and device design.

Safe and Fun



Safety and fun are paramount in children's playgrounds. All landscape installations created through 3D printing have rounded, smooth edges without sharp corners, preventing potential bumps and injuries during play. At the same time, the cave scene is closely integrated with activities such as slides, tunnels, and speaking tubes, creating a wonderful unity of form and function between the garden environment and children's activities.
